This is good advice - I used the PDA and printed off the copy to send to the DWP. The PDA automatically fits what you type into the space available so you don't end up with reams of extra sheets as you would do handwriting it. I would also recommend returning the form via some sort of recorded delivery so that you have proof you sent it in good time.
